Chapter 1: The Invisible Living World – Cells
1. What Are Living Things Made Up Of?
Key Concept
Just like a building is made up of bricks, living organisms are made up of tiny units called
cells. A cell is the basic structural and functional unit of life.
2. Types of Organisms
Unicellular Organisms
• These organisms are made up of a single cell.
• They are microscopic and cannot be seen with the naked eye.
Examples: Bacteria, Amoeba, Paramecium, and Yeast.
Multicellular Organisms
• These organisms are made up of many cells.
• Different cells work together to perform various functions.
Examples: Humans, Animals, Birds, Trees, and Plants.
3. Discovery of the Cell
• Cells were first discovered by Robert Hooke in 1665.
• He observed a thin slice of cork under a microscope.
